HTML DOM 입력 텍스트 객체

Input Text 对象

Input Text 对象代表带有 type="text" 的 HTML <input> 元素。

访问 Input Text 对象

您可以使用 getElementById() 访问 type="text" 的 <input> 元素:

var x = document.getElementById("myText");

직접 테스트해 보세요

提示:您还可以通过搜索表单的 elements 集合 来访问 <input type="text">。

创建 Input Text 对象

您可以使用 document.createElement() 方法创建 type="text" 的 <input> 元素:

var x = document.createElement("INPUT");
x.setAttribute("type", "text");

직접 테스트해 보세요

Input Text 객체 속성

속성 설명
autocomplete 텍스트 필드의 autocomplete 속성 값을 설정하거나 반환합니다.
autofocus 페이지가 로드될 때 텍스트 필드가 자동으로 포커스를 받도록 설정하거나 반환합니다.
defaultValue 텍스트 필드의 기본 값을 설정하거나 반환합니다.
disabled 텍스트 필드가 비활성화되어 있는지 설정하거나 반환합니다.
form 텍스트 필드를 포함한 양식에 대한 참조를 반환합니다.
list 텍스트 필드를 포함한 데이터 목록에 대한 참조를 반환합니다.
maxLength 텍스트 필드의 maxlength 속성 값을 설정하거나 반환합니다.
name 텍스트 필드의 name 속성 값을 설정하거나 반환합니다.
pattern 텍스트 필드의 pattern 속성 값을 설정하거나 반환합니다.
placeholder 텍스트 필드의 placeholder 속성 값을 설정하거나 반환합니다.
readOnly 텍스트 필드가 읽기 전용인지 설정하거나 반환합니다.
required 텍스트 필드가 제출 전에 반드시 입력해야 하는지 설정하거나 반환합니다.
size 텍스트 필드의 size 속성 값을 설정하거나 반환합니다.
type 텍스트 필드가哪种类型的表单元素를 반환합니다.
value 텍스트 필드의 value 속성 값을 설정하거나 반환합니다.

Input Text 객체 메서드

메서드 설명
blur() 텍스트 필드에서 포커스를 제거합니다.
focus() 텍스트 필드에 포커스를 부여합니다.
select() 텍스트 필드의 내용을 선택합니다.

표준 속성과 이벤트를 지원합니다.

Input Text 객체는 표준속성이벤트

관련 페이지

HTML 강의:HTML 양식

HTML 참조 설명서:HTML <input> 태그

HTML 참조 설명서:HTML <input> type 속성